Get started7 Sherbrook Avenue is a three-bedroom semi-detached house in Daybrook, Nottingham, Nottingham (NG5 6AN). It has a recorded floor area of 73 m² (around 786 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1930-1949 and council tax band A. The latest certificate (May 2024) shows a D (score 63),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. When first surveyed in October 2012 the rating was E, the property has climbed 1 band since. Between certificates, window efficiency went from Average to Good, hot-water efficiency went from Poor to Good and lighting went from Average to Very Good; while roof efficiency dropped from Average to Very Poor. The recommended improvements would lift it to B (score 88), a 2-band jump. Other recorded features include a basement.
Held since December 2004 — that's 21 years off the open market, well above the local norm. Sale prices here have outpaced England HPI: 12.4% per year against 0% for the wider region. Today's modelled estimate of £181,000 sits 64.5% above the 2004 sale of £110,000.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£140/sq ft) was about 35.2% above the typical sold price in the postcode. At 73 m² it's 17.7% larger than the typical home in the postcode (62 m² median across 9 EPCs).
